Output e2116e83f95419c022c0b9ee03e71d9d50dca3d2885e625a79aa2004bcb6f9a6:6

value
84180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ff02cb797882c5e4bdb12f9ef52d4e2332b8abb0 OP_EQUAL
address
3QwPaeYgPv81bYacfewPv7ggg2d5y8zu7T
transaction
e2116e83f95419c022c0b9ee03e71d9d50dca3d2885e625a79aa2004bcb6f9a6
spent
true